Subject: Links Golf Course Maintenance – Fairway Oaks

Mr. Jack Mariano,

On behalf of the Fairway Oaks Homeowners Association, which represents all homeowners in Fairway Oaks, we would like to bring to your attention an ongoing nuisance with the now defunct Links Golf Course owned by Matt Lowman.

We have received numerous complaints from our homeowners about the unsightly condition of the Golf Course, which we all strongly believe has brought down the values of our properties.  There are homeless people living on hole 13. The Course has been operating as a Tree Farm.  Initially, there had been some maintenance done to the property, but since the change from Golf Course to Tree Farm, all mowings have stopped.

In an earlier letter of April 22, 2019, from Mr. Lowman to the Associations, he indicated that “all homeowners and Associations will be kept aware of any changes or conditions that affect the property”.  Unfortunately, this has not happened, and our efforts to contact Mr. Lowman for some dialogue regarding his responsibilities have all failed.

In our opinion we feel that he is blatantly trying to annoy us because we did not adhere to his ridiculous requests for financial assistance.  His property is not being maintained. he has rented out parts of his business, pro shop and golf cart barn, to others.  As far as we have been told, this is illegal.

We are all very disappointed and very frustrated with what Mr. Lowman is doing to our subdivision, and we are asking that you all look into this situation, that has clearly gone too far.  We would also like your input as to what other actions we may take, as an Association, on behalf of all our homeowners.

Subject: RE: Links Golf Course Maintenance – Fairway Oaks

Good morning and thank you reaching out to me regarding your concerns about the Links Golf Course.  The Board has asked the County Attorney to bring back an Ordinance to help deal with issue of lack of maintenance of Golf Courses that no longer have play. This is among several other ordinances that the County Attorney is drafting. This particular ordinance was currently scheduled for the first part of 2020 but because of the COVID-19 pandemic it has obviously been pushed back a little.  Once this is completed it should clear up several concerns that you have.  It is my understanding that SWFWMD has been contacted to assure that the stormwater system continues to be maintained and functional.
